What is Neuro Linguistic Programming?

Neuro linguistic programming studies the ways our thoughts affect our behavior. It looks at the ways our brains interpret the signals they receive and how these interpretations affect what we do. It does this through language – the linguistic part of neuro-linguistic programming techniques. By examining how our brains process information, NLP techniques help us to look at our thoughts, feelings and emotions as things that we can control, rather than things that passively happen to us.

What Do the Words Neuro, Linguistic, and Programming Means?

Neuro-Linguistic Programming is a set of skills that reveal the kind of communication that matters most – on the inside and out. For many, it’s clarifying to offer a definition by showing what we mean by the words neuro, linguistic, and programming. Here you go:

Neuro: Referring to the mind or brain, particularly regarding how states of mind (and body) affect communication and behavior. NLP teaches a structural way of viewing mind and body states, developing mental maps that show how things happen and how to change course.

Linguistic: Meaning that our mind and body states are revealed in our language and non-verbal communication. Language is the tool we use to gain access to the inner workings of the mind. Neuro-linguistic programming language patterns teach us how to access unconscious information that would remain vague and unknowable otherwise.

Programming: This refers to the capacity to change our mind and body states. You’ve heard the term living on autopilot, right? To someone trained, this would mean that you are living according to your programming, which consists of habitual thoughts, feelings, reactions, beliefs, and traditions.

How Does NLP Work?

Neuro-linguistic programming is intended to help clients understand their own minds and how they come to think and behave the way they do. With the aid of NLP techniques, clients can learn to manage their moods and emotions and "reprogram" the way they process information. At the same time, NLP is designed to help clients see why they have been successful in the past and determine how they can most easily and efficiently repeat that success in other areas of their lives. NLP therapists believe that their clients have the answers to their problems within themselves; it is simply a matter of helping them draw out those answers.

Therapists who practice NLP often start by building a rapport with their client, mirroring the client’s verbal and nonverbal behavior to create empathy and connection. They will gather information about the client’s objectives and identify problem areas to work on. Along the way, they may correct any language that leads to negative thinking and faulty communication. NLP-based therapy will conclude with a plan for how the client can continue to integrate the positive behavioral changes into their daily life.

NLP therapy can be short-term or long-term, depending on the individual and the extent of the problem.

What is Neuro Linguistic Programming Used For?

Neuro-linguistic programming has been applied to achieve personal development or work-related goals, including increasing productivity and moving forward in one’s career.

It has also been used in the treatment of mental health issues such as:

- Anxiety

- Depression

- Fears and phobias

- Poor self-esteem

- Weight management

- Substance misuse

- Stress

- Post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D)

Most studies addressing the effectiveness of NLP in treating these issues have been small in scale and have had mixed results.

Is Neuro Linguistic Programming Real?

Lack of empirical evidence and anecdotal support has become the cause of NLP sometimes being branded a pseudoscience. However, more and more peer reviews have recently shown that NLP techniques help manage self-esteem and work-related stress. Moreover, a 2021 study showed that NLP techniques enabled 180 nurses to improve their work quality and be more satisfied with their jobs.

The growing recent evidence and outstanding personal and professional results from NLP students show that this approach works. Yes, there needs to be robust research to remove the stigma created by poor initial studies; however, more of NLP’s criticism stems from the fact that there needs to be more credible research, not that the approach does not work.

What is the Difference Between Neuroplasticity and NLP?

Neuroplasticity refers to the brain’s ability to change and adapt. In this sense, neural pathways can still develop and disconnect throughout our lives. Your actions and experiences influence these brain changes, especially the learning of something new. The practice of neurolinguistic programming can potentially lead to new neural connections as you learn and implement new habits and skills. However, this is theoretically true for any new thing you learn in life, not a quality of NLP per se.

Who Developed Neuro Linguistic Programming?

NLP was founded in the 1970s at the University of California, Santa Cruz, by Richard Bandler, a mathematician and information scientist, and John Grinder, a linguist. They came together to release a book called The Structure of Magic I: A Book about Language and Therapy. In this book, they identified patterns based on the modeling of renowned therapists Fritz Perls, Virginia Satir, and a well-known psychiatrist Milton Erickson, which gave birth to the meta-model and Milton model, respectively. 

Other notable techniques included in the book came from Gregory Bateson’s work on cybernetics and Naom Chomsky’s work on linguistics. All these practices combine in NLP to provide identification of language patterns describing how each individual perceives their reality and to change them for better outcomes. 

The Four Pillars of the Neuro Linguistic Programming

Rapport

NLP provides an important gift to build relationships with other people. Rapport can be described as connecting quickly with others. Creating rapport creates trust from others. Rapport can be built quickly through understanding modality preferences, eye accessing cues and predicates.

Sensory Awareness

Sometimes when you walk into someone’s home, you notice that the colors, smells, and sounds are subtly quite different from yours. Neuro linguistic programming enables you to notice that your world is much richer when you deliberately pay attention to your senses wholly.

Outcome Thinking

An outcome is your goal for doing something. Outcome connects to thinking about what you want, as opposed to getting stuck in a negative mode of thinking. The principles of outcome approach may help to make the best decisions and choices.

Behavioral Flexibility

Behavioral flexibility means being able to do something differently if the way you’re currently doing it isn’t working. Being flexible is a key aspect of practicing NLP. Learning NLP helps you to find fresh perspectives and to build these habits into your repertoire.

Top 10 NLP Techniques

NLP techniques are practical, and there is an infinite number. Here are the 10 common NLP techniques that NLP practitioners use.

1. Dissociation

NLP techniques of disassociation can help you get rid of bad feelings or experiences. For it, identify the emotion that you want to get rid of. It can include any fear, rage, nervousness, or discomfort in any situation. Now, imagine you can come out of your body and look back at yourself having this emotion or entire circumstance. This will help you to disassociate yourself from any negative feelings.

2. Reframing

Reframing is one of the most remarkable NLP techniques that will take any negative situation. Reframing is about empowering you by changing the mind map into something positive. For example, if you feel nervous speaking in public, you can reframe this situation as an exciting growth challenge. Let’s say your relationship ends. It can be a disturbing situation for you. But you can reframe it into a positive. For example, you have the freedom to do anything you want to do. You’re open to another relationship. You learned many lessons from this relationship. These examples are all about reframing a negative situation to a positive one by clearing your head & changing the meaning of experience. 

3. Anchoring yourself

Anchoring yourself helps you associate any positive sensory experience with a particular emotional state. This NLP technique can be used anytime to change your mood. For example, when you choose positive emotion and intentionally connect it to any simple gesture, you can trigger this sensory experience anytime whenever you’re feeling low. Your feelings will change quickly, and you can feel that emotion.

4. Priming

One of the common NLP techniques, Priming, is more manipulative. Priming is a technique to adjust your thoughts. Moreover, it helps us to make faster decisions. For example, we use phrases like this in coaching the clients. I know you’re changing, and it is good. So, in this way, we’re priming the client to change. 

5. Bad memories

This NLP technique is dedicated to helping people to remove negative thoughts and feelings associated with bad memories. It can be any experience or any trauma. 

6. Mental rehearsal

Mental rehearsal is the unique NLP technique that is based on visualization. This technique is about creating imaginary training of yourself performing an action successfully. In addition, it is beneficial to improve confidence and make you believe in yourself & your abilities. 

7. Belief changes

The power of belief is highly classic. This NLP technique examines your beliefs. Any thought or limiting belief that lets you down can be deconstructed by identifying and overcoming them. If you believe that you’re not good enough to do this, you probably can not do this. If you think you can do something, you can surely do it. Once you change this belief, you’ll start taking more significant risks to achieve more meaningful goals.

8. Mental maps

For many people, speaking in front of a large audience fills them with fear & anxiety. So, the best way to overcome this fear is to look at yourself from a different perspective. For example, by looking at yourself from the eyes of the observer. This NLP technique is about looking at the situation from a different view. When we see the situation from a different scenario, we get to know what the situation really is. It helps you mentally prepare for the situation that makes you feel apprehensive.

9. Mirroring

Mirroring is an NLP technique used to build rapport with anyone by leveraging body language during the conversation. According to research, your tone of voice and body language communicates 93% of your messages more than your words. When talking with someone, mirror your body language according to theirs. If they’re calm and relaxed, you will do the same. It’ll decrease the chance of friction during the discussion, and other people will find you trustworthy. Hence, it is a great technique to get along with anyone.

10. NLP swish

NLP Swish is the advanced NLP technique that is about changing thoughts & behaviour patterns to come to the desired outcome rather than the undesired outcome. Hence, if you link any emotion to an unwanted experience, NLP swish is a technique to disrupt that link. Also, it trains your brain to strengthen positives and weaken negatives.

What to Expect from Neuro-Linguistic Programming

Based on their sensory experiences, people develop their own preferred representational system (PRS) or unique way of viewing the world. Therapists may employ NLP techniques to identify their client’s specific PRS and adjust their communication style and therapeutic goals accordingly.

Some common NLP techniques include but are not limited to:

Anchoring: Associating an external or internal trigger with a healthier response until it becomes automatic

Belief changing: Replacing negative thoughts or beliefs that prevent the client from achieving their desires

Reframing: Putting a situation in a different context to elicit an adaptive reaction instead of following the same maladaptive behavioral patterns

Visualization: Forming a mental image of something the client wants

Visual-kinesthetic dissociation: Guiding the client in reliving trauma by evoking an imaginative out-of-body experience

What Happens in an NLP Session

While the methods used by professionals will differ, a standard NLP coaching session will follow the same, basic pattern. Initially, the practitioner will ask what you want to change and the problems you want to overcome. They will pay close attention to what you’re saying and how you say it, tailoring the session to your responses.

The NLP practitioner will then work through a range of exercises with you in order to piece together your “life map”. They will begin to introduce new thought processes in order to help you widen your boundaries.

It is common for the practitioner to give you exercises to practice at home. This will help you get accustomed to the techniques learnt in the NLP coaching session. While the main neurological changes will have occurred during the session, they may take time to settle in. It is normal for the changes to progress over time, as you get back into your daily routine.

They may ask you to record how you felt before, during and after sessions. This is so you and the NLP practitioner can look back on the results. You will also make note of any changes you have noticed since starting the sessions and record any at-home exercises you have completed. When you are ready, both you and the practitioner will decide on the next stage of your life and what change to begin.

It is thought that NLP is becoming a popular technique because it focuses on the future. It works to explore future possibilities and solutions, rather than encouraging you to dig up past memories or experiences. NLP coaching is about adding opportunities and widening perceptions, rather than dwelling on the negatives.
